A novel transient liquid crystal technique to determine heat transfer coefficient distributions and adiabatic wall temperature in a three-temperature problem

Transient liquid crystal techniques are widely used for experimental heat transfer measurements. In many instances it is necessary to model the heat transfer resulting from the temperature difference between a mixture of two gas streams and a solid surface.
